Operating Instructions
4. SPINDLE LOCK BUTTON
Clean the grinder spindle and all parts to be mounted. For clamping and loosening the
grinding tools, lock the grinder spindle with the spindle lock button.
WARNING:
Actuate the spindle lock button only when the grinder spindle is at a
standstill!
5. USING THE TURNABLE HANDLE (SEE FIG D)
To best suit the different working positions, your angle grinder is equipped with a turnable handle.
Press the rear of the locking button (2) on the turnable handle and you can rotate the
handle 90
o
to left or right. Then release the locking button. A click will be heard, when the
handle is then fully locked in place.
WARNING:
Make sure the handle is in the locked position before starting the angle
grinder. Rotate the turnable handle only when the grinder is switched off and the disc has
completely stopped.
6. HAND GRIP AREAS (SEE FIG E)
Always hold your angle grinder firmly with both hands when operating.
7. SAFETY LOCK-OFF SWITCH (SEE FIG F)
Your angle grinder switch is locked off to prevent accidental starting. With your hand on the on/
off switch (a) use your finger to push lever (b) forward and then depress on/off switch (a). Then
release lever (b). Your tool is now on. To switch off just release on/off switch (a).
